About Wagga Wagga 2650

The size of Wagga Wagga is approximately 8.9 square kilometres. It has 13 parks covering nearly 21% of total area. The population of Wagga Wagga in 2011 was 6,961 people. By 2016 the population was 7,109 showing a population growth of 2.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Wagga Wagga is 20-29 years. Households in Wagga Wagga are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Wagga Wagga work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 47.8% of the homes in Wagga Wagga were owner-occupied compared with 45.5% in 2016.

Wagga Wagga has 6,054 properties.
